Groups | Search | Server Info | Keyboard shortcuts | Login | Register
Groups > linux.debian.maint.java > #12979
| From | tony mancill <tmancill@debian.org> |
|---|---|
| Newsgroups | linux.debian.maint.java |
| Subject | Re: Update of XMLUnit |
| Date | 2025-05-01 23:00 +0200 |
| Message-ID | <KHJaF-3BV-5@gated-at.bofh.it> (permalink) |
| References | <KHlUJ-hpWO-3@gated-at.bofh.it> <KHm4p-hpZX-1@gated-at.bofh.it> <KHJaF-3BV-7@gated-at.bofh.it> <KHAAp-hz5m-5@gated-at.bofh.it> |
| Organization | linux.* mail to news gateway |
[Multipart message — attachments visible in raw view] - view raw
Hi Mechtilde, After reviewing the migration guide [1] and noting that XMLUnit2 has changes licenses from BSD to Apache 2.0, I recommend creating a new source package xmlunit2. That will permit you to upload the new source package to unstable now instead of experimental and/or waiting until after trixie is released. During the forky (trixie+1) release cycle, we can set a release goal of updating packages that still use XMLUunit 1.x to use xmlunit-legacy. Once there are no more reverse-dependencies, we can ask for removal of xmlunit(1). Thank you for coordinating on the list and for packaging XMLUnit 2.x. Cheers, tony [1] https://github.com/xmlunit/user-guide/wiki/Migrating-from-XMLUnit-1.x-to-2.x On Thu, May 01, 2025 at 01:25:16PM +0200, Mechtilde wrote: > Hello, > > Do you have any problems if I start directly with a version 2 of xmlunit. > > It will create some more binaries > > And two of them I need for the next version of JVerein using E-Invoice. > > Regards > > Mechtilde > > Am 30.04.25 um 22:18 schrieb Vladimir Petko: > > Hi, > > > > The library has a number of reverse dependencies: libjson-java, > > apktool, xmlunit, libspring-java, maven-shade-plugin, biojava6-live, > > fop, maven, mondrian, ez-vcard, aptly, maven-repo-helper, > > jenkins-json, jgrapht, biojava4-live, libxml-security-java. > > It would be prudent to check if they build/work with the new version > > of the library. If there are no breakages, then it is safe to proceed > > with the upgrade, otherwise, we need to check what breaks and decide > > if it is something we want to fix or if we are better off with > > libxmlunit2-java. > > > > Best Regards, > > Vladimir. > > > > On Thu, May 1, 2025 at 8:00 AM Mechtilde Stehmann <mechtilde@debian.org> wrote: > > > > > > Hello, > > > > > > I want to package libmustang-cli-java (Bug#1094988) > > > > > > Therefore I need xmlunit-core and xmlunit-assertj. > > > > > > I find the sources under https://github.com/xmlunit/xmlunit/tree/main > > > > > > Should I update https://salsa.debian.org/java-team/xmlunit to version > > > 2.10 or ... > > > > > > Should I better create a new package libxmlunit2-java > > > > > > Kind regards
Back to linux.debian.maint.java | Previous | Next — Previous in thread | Find similar
Update of XMLUnit Mechtilde Stehmann <mechtilde@debian.org> - 2025-04-30 22:10 +0200
Re: Update of XMLUnit Vladimir Petko <vladimir.petko@canonical.com> - 2025-04-30 22:20 +0200
Re: Update of XMLUnit Mechtilde <ooo@mechtilde.de> - 2025-05-01 13:50 +0200
Re: Update of XMLUnit tony mancill <tmancill@debian.org> - 2025-05-01 23:00 +0200
csiph-web